Summary
Aimee Coughlin is a security-focused software engineer with 11 years of experience building and hardening systems across corporate and adversarial settings. She spent multiple years on Facebook’s Red Team and Corporate Security, developing implants, C2 frameworks, device management and zero-trust tooling, and driving incident response and vulnerability remediation. Now at Arista Networks, she applies that offensive and defensive depth to production networking software. Her background blends rigorous academic research in networking and security (PhD work at University of Colorado Boulder) with hands-on engineering from internships to large-scale operational programs. Notably, she has led corporate container security and hardware-backed PKI efforts, showing a knack for turning research-grade ideas into practical, organization-wide controls.
